LARGE NURSING HOME IN THE WEST MIDLANDS

Overview:

Challenge:
A nursing home in the Midlands contacted MJS Energy with the goal of removing their reliance on fossil fuels.

Their existing boilers were nearing the end of their lifespan, and they sought a renewable heating solution to ensure efficiency, sustainability, and cost-effectiveness. Additionally, they wanted to take advantage of the Renewable Heat Incentive (RHI) scheme.

Solution:
MJS Energy designed and implemented a renewable heating system tailored to the nursing home’s needs.

The installation included:

  • A 199kW ETA wood pellet boiler to heat one section of the nursing home.
  • A 130kW ETA wood pellet boiler to heat another section of the nursing home.
  • A full turnkey solution that involved constructing a new energy centre and fuel store to support the efficient operation of the biomass system.
